Address 0 PPC

PEhdvG1sQWqNWS377rtXKwu7ZneESWKPaC

Confirmed

Total Received5.140655 PPC
Total Sent5.140655 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PEhdvG1sQWqNWS377rtXKwu7ZneESWKPaC5.140655 PPC
Fee: 0.00225 PPC
27516 Confirmations5.138405 PPC
PEhdvG1sQWqNWS377rtXKwu7ZneESWKPaC5.140655 PPC
PSaDNpifqvACTqvpCZA3yd391usnH7taRZ39.277435 PPC
Fee: 0.00191 PPC
27561 Confirmations44.41809 PPC